Terra-firma forme dermatosis (TFFD), also known as Duncan’s dirty dermatosis, is characterized by “dirt-like” brown-grey cutaneous patches and plaques. Abnormal and delayed keratinization has been implicated in its pathogenesis. The disorder is not well known by dermatologists even though affected patients present with typical dirt-like lesions. TFFD can be easily diagnosed and treated with 70% isopropyl alcohol. It is important to recognize this benign dermatologic entity because it can be easily confused with many other dermatological conditions. Hence, in order to avoid unnecessary referrals, laboratory investigations, skin biopsies, and medications, a trial of wiping the skin lesion with 70% isopropyl alcohol pads is suggested whenever the diagnosis of TFFD is considered. In this article, the author is reporting three new cases of TFFD.
